[04] How it earns
One deposit is priced once into shares. Adapters spread it across lending pools, a bounded engine reweights it, and the price per share carries the result. Six steps, one ledger, nothing to claim.
01
That is your entire job. One approval, one transaction. The vault does the rest and there is nothing to configure.
02
You get deposit ÷ price-per-share in shares. Yield arrives as that price rising. Same shares in month six, worth more USDG.
03
Deposits gather in an idle buffer and enter pools in batches, so gas is shared across the batch. Small depositors get large-depositor economics.
04
Every pool sits behind an adapter and is scored on liquidity, utilization, rate volatility and age. Weights follow the score, never the headline APY.
05
A keeper closes the gap to target only when the extra yield beats gas and slippage. Drift under the threshold sits. A cooldown stops oscillation.
06
Ordinary redemptions are served from the buffer without touching a pool. Larger ones unwind in a defined order, filled in full or reverted.

[05] Allocation engine
Every pool carries a risk-adjusted score built from what can be measured on-chain. Weights follow the score, hard ceilings override the weights, and the keeper only moves when the move pays.
Live now
01
How deep the pool is, how large you would be inside it, and how much is already borrowed. A pool at 99% utilization pays well because nobody can leave.
02
Supplying capital lowers utilization, which lowers the rate. The engine optimizes for what the vault will actually receive after the allocation exists.
03
No pool exceeds a maximum share of the vault regardless of score. Each adapter passes an audit and an observation period at limited size first.
04
Rebalances clear a deviation threshold and a hard cooldown. Spikes are usually one borrower leaving an hour later. Allocation follows sustained change, not noise.
The loop
Post-deposit rate, not headline rate
Spread thin. Earn more.
Supplying capital lowers utilization, which lowers the rate. Yield curves flatten as you push into them, so one pool is usually worse than several before risk is even counted. Spreading lets each position sit on the steeper part of its own curve.
Open vaultWho moves it
A keeper, bounded.
Anyone can trigger it. It cannot send funds outside registered adapters, exceed a ceiling, or skip the cooldown. Its freedom is when, never where.
Why it holds
Min-output or revert.
Every rebalance carries an on-chain minimum-output check. A move that would execute worse than expected reverts instead of completing at a bad price.

[08] Where the risk lives
Anyone describing a yield product without naming its failure modes is describing a brochure. There are three real ones, and each has a bounded answer.
01
Mosaic supplies USDG to lending protocols. If one suffers a critical failure, the capital in that pool is at risk. This is why allocation is spread and capped: a failing pool should scratch the portfolio, not erase it.
02
Pooled capital is a target. The mitigation is a small core that does not change, complexity pushed into adapters that can be disabled individually, independent audits, a conservative deposit cap, and an emergency withdraw path.
03
A model can be well-built and still misjudge, so it is bounded rather than trusted. Weight ceilings, pool caps, cooldowns and profitability checks make a bad decision expensive to no one and survivable by everyone.

The vault holds one number, total assets, against one supply of shares. Price per share is assets divided by shares. When you deposit you receive deposit ÷ price in shares; as pools pay interest, assets grow and the price rises. Your entry never dilutes anyone and theirs never dilutes you.
